The textarea field represents a multi-line text input. It should be used for content values that are long strings: for example, a page description.

interface TextareaConfig {
  name: string
  component: 'textarea'
  label?: string
  description?: string
}| Option | Description | 
|---|---|
component | The name of the plugin component. Always 'textarea'. | 
name | The path to some value in the data being edited. | 
label | A human readable label for the field. Defaults to the name. (Optional) | 
description | Description that expands on the purpose of the field or prompts a specific action. (Optional) | 
This interfaces only shows the keys unique to the textarea field.
Visit the Field Config docs for a complete list of options.
Below is an example of how a textarea field could be used to edit the description of a blog post.
const BlogPostForm = {
  fields: [
    {
      name: 'description',
      component: 'textarea',
      label: 'Description',
      description: 'Enter the post description here',
    },
  ],
}
